本文作者:adminc

通达信股票交易软件智能量化分析与实战选股策略深度解析教程

通达信股票交易软件智能量化分析与实战选股策略深度解析教程摘要: 通达信交易软件技术文档1. 核心功能概述通达信交易软件作为国内主流证券分析平台,集行情分析、技术指标开发、量化交易支持于一体。其核心功能覆盖:1. 多市场行情覆盖:支持A股、港股、...

通达信交易软件技术文档

1. 核心功能概述

通达信交易软件作为国内主流证券分析平台,集行情分析、技术指标开发、量化交易支持于一体。其核心功能覆盖:

1. 多市场行情覆盖:支持A股、港股、期货等市场的实时行情接收与历史数据回溯;

2. 自定义指标开发:提供技术指标公式编辑器,允许用户编写MACD、KDJ等复杂策略;

3. 自动化交易接口:通过API实现程序化交易指令下发与账户管理;

4. 个性化界面配置:支持分屏视图、自定义K线周期与颜色主题。

该软件尤其适合技术派投资者与量化开发者,其公式系统支持超200种内置函数,可构建从均线变色到资金流向分析等高级模型。

2. 软件界面导航

通达信界面分为三大核心模块:

2.1 行情报价区

  • 快捷键:`.005`可快速切换至用户自定义版面;
  • 功能操作:支持添加自选股、设置涨速监控(周期可调),并可通过右键菜单启动“区间统计”功能。
  • 2.2 K线分析区

  • 叠加功能:支持多股叠加与多周期切换(日线/周线/月线);
  • 画线工具:提供趋势线、黄金分割等8类绘图工具,数据保存于`Line.dat`文件。
  • 2.3 公式编辑器

  • 入口路径:`功能→公式系统→公式管理器(Ctrl+F)`;
  • 调试流程:新建公式→插入函数→语法检测→主图/副图加载。
  • 3. 指标公式开发

    通达信股票交易软件智能量化分析与实战选股策略深度解析教程

    3.1 公式分类

    | 类型 | 用途 | 示例函数 |

    | 技术指标公式 | 生成MACD等分析曲线 | `MA(CLOSE,N)` |

    | 条件选股公式 | 筛选特定形态股票 | `VOL/REF(VOL,1)>2` |

    | 专家系统公式 | 生成买卖信号标记 | `CROSS(MA5,MA10)` |

    | 五彩K线公式 | 高亮显示特殊K线形态 | `CLOSE>OPEN AND VOL>REF`|

    (数据来源:)

    3.2 参数配置要点

  • 变量定义:通过`N:=14;`声明周期参数,支持动态调整;
  • 错误排查:常见错误包括中文标点符号、未定义变量,报错信息显示于编辑器底部;
  • 代码优化:避免使用超过50个变量,防止性能下降。
  • 4. 系统参数配置

    4.1 运行环境要求

    | 组件 | 最低配置 | 推荐配置 |

    | 操作系统 | Windows 7 | Windows 10/11 |

    | 处理器 | Intel i3 2.4GHz | Intel i5 3.0GHz |

    | 内存 | 4GB | 8GB |

    | 磁盘空间 | 2GB(历史数据需额外10GB)| SSD 256GB |

    | 网络带宽 | 10Mbps | 50Mbps(高频交易场景) |

    (参考:文件目录结构分析)

    4.2 关键文件说明

  • 数据存储
  • `vipdoc/`:历史行情数据(按市场分目录存储);
  • `T0002/blocknew/`:自选股与板块文件;
  • 个性化配置
  • `user.ini`:全局界面参数;
  • `Scheme.dat`:配色方案存档。
  • 5. 高阶应用场景

    5.1 量化交易集成

    通过`Api.dll`接口实现自动化交易:

    1. 初始化流程

    python

    from tdx_api import TradeAPI

    api = TradeAPI

    if api.Init < 1:

    print("API初始化失败")

    2. 指令下发:支持限价单、市价单及条件单,委托状态可通过`QueryOrder`实时查询。

    5.2 云端部署方案

  • 数据同步:利用`qh/`目录存储期货数据,配合rsync实现多节点同步;
  • 负载均衡:建议将`vipdoc/`目录挂载至NAS设备,降低单机IO压力。
  • 6. 常见问题处理

    | 问题类型 | 解决方案 | 相关文件 |

    | 指标加载失败 | 检查`PriCS.dat`中的公式模板完整性 | |

    | 行情延迟 | 清理`zst_cache/`分时图缓存 | |

    | API连接超时 | 验证`ldnetcfg.dbf`中的网卡配置 | |

    | 界面布局错乱 | 重置`padinfo.dat`自定义版面配置文件 | |

    通达信交易软件凭借其高度可定制性与强大的数据分析能力,已成为专业投资者的核心工具。用户可通过本文档的系统性指引,充分挖掘软件在策略回测、实时监控等场景的应用潜力。进一步的技术细节可参考官方文档或开发者社区案例。

    阅读
    分享

    发表评论

    快捷回复:

    验证码

    评论列表 (暂无评论,7人围观)参与讨论

    还没有评论,来说两句吧...